Output e886c7421120d6a1331383129c0bb5d52bb6f230ca6675eb856c9daec278c5eb:1

value
107893766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8314cd63cf5f9b22b118b494575ed7c0fb49e0 OP_EQUAL
address
MHhdZeAYvymAHoEQPURM6RgLAVXMhh9DXM
transaction
e886c7421120d6a1331383129c0bb5d52bb6f230ca6675eb856c9daec278c5eb
spent
true